The world's first electronic presentation of documents (ePresentation) into India has been sent over Bolero's online network, suggesting a growing demand for electronic trade processes into and out of the country.

The transaction involved an ePresentation issued subject to eUCP against a letter of credit (L/C) for a copper shipment.

The beneficiary was a major international mining company, which shipped a consignment of copper to a Mumbai-based buyer.

Bolero expects this latest industry first will pave the way for other international banks and corporates to move towards digitised trade into and out of India in the coming year.

eUCP standard

The ePresentation platform, which is underpinned by the International Chamber of Commerce's eUCP standard, can be utilised to legally replace original paper documents with acceptable electronic ones.

According to Bolero, as well as accelerating the speed at which the documents are delivered, the ability to exchange 'machine-readable' structured data creates further opportunities for straight-through processing.
